Transaction 1008e21c6729469ec8f7d10fe33c914f0858645960fe01fd65b9b02621f83ded
1 Input
1 Output
-
1008e21c6729469ec8f7d10fe33c914f0858645960fe01fd65b9b02621f83ded:0
- value
- 14988
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6e1ccbfb63660781c563b3149269d569ada31a9 OP_EQUAL
- address
- 3KpcDNVTWbPcKU5JUuNsgh9yK5YS4WB7TJ